Handover: Exportron retry queue

Hi Mira — handing over the failed-export retries. Exports that hit a timeout land in the retry queue and get three attempts with backoff; after that they're parked and need a manual requeue from the admin panel. Watch for customers reporting duplicates — that usually means a double requeue. The current retry settings are as follows.

settings of bajog-fawig:
oliael:
  log_level: warn
  metrics_host: metrics.oliael.zemvarsys.internal
  pin: 0267
  pool_size: 32

**Runbook: Restarting the Tillerby kiosk watchdog.** If a kiosk shows the frozen-screen logo, the watchdog has likely stalled rather than the app itself. SSH into the unit, run `tillctl watchdog status`, and if the heartbeat age exceeds 90 seconds, issue `tillctl watchdog restart`. Wait two minutes before declaring success; the splash screen is normal. Record the incident in the shift log, including the build token shown below.

trace token, fafog-kageg: htk4_98e6

## Local Setup

Getting SproutCycle running locally is pretty painless. Clone the repo, run `make bootstrap`, and the scheduler daemon plus the mock sprinkler API will spin up on their default ports. You'll need Postgres 15 running locally — the seed script creates the `sprout_dev` database for you. Before tagging a release, double-check migrations apply cleanly from scratch. The scheduler reads its connection settings from the value below.

primary connection of tajeg-tajop = postgresql://julax_svc:DI@db-e7f3.kelvidyn.corp:5432/rusdor

Step 4: Partition the audit_events table by month. Renvik's schema tool creates one child partition per calendar month plus a default catch-all; verify that row-level security policies propagate to each child before cutover. Review the generated DDL in the migration bundle for grant statements. To inspect the partitioned staging copy, connect using the credentials that follow.

database URL for kahip-tawep: postgresql://druix_svc:XpEf7Qn4IltxYW@db-9d5d.urlaqtech.corp:5432/sorwyn